In this thesis it was my objective to analyze the figures of the two protagonists, Bess in "Breaking the Waves" and Selma in "Dancer in the Dark", with particular attention to their individuality and peculiarities. The two films are part of the "Golden Heart Trilogy", which focuses on the goodness that characterizes the protagonists, and thanks to which the director Lars von Trier brings into vogue the hypocritical and cruel nature of the society where we live. Furthermore, in the thesis I also analyze the two protagonists from a melodramatic point of view: in fact, they perfectly embody the heroines of melodrama, who literally go so far as to sacrifice themselves in favor of their own goal or to protect a loved one.
